PAKISTAN’S climate debate is finally beginning to move beyond post-disaster calls for aid and donor conferences. Finance Minister Muhammad Aurangzeb has implicitly acknowledged that the era when the world could be expected to step in generously after a climate disaster is effectively over. His remarks at the Breathe Pakistan Climate Conference on Wednesday were an admission that Pakistan must first demonstrate seriousness at home before looking for external help.
